What areolas look like in early pregnancy?

It's also not just dark areolas that you might begin to see in early pregnancy—the area immediately surrounding your areolas may begin to darken as well, almost resembling a web, which can make the areola look even bigger, says Sara Twogood, MD, an ob-gyn at Cedars-Sinai Medical Center in Los Angeles.

What early pregnancy nipples look like?

The nipples and the area around the nipples (areola) become darker and larger. Small bumps may appear on the areola. These bumps will go away after you have your baby. Some women get stretch marks on their breasts.

At what stage of pregnancy does the areola darken?

Over the course of the second and third trimesters, the areolas often become larger and darker. Darkening areolas are likely to result from hormonal changes. Often, the areola returns to its prepregnancy color after breastfeeding, but it sometimes remains a shade or two darker than it was originally.

How soon after conception do areolas darken?

The color of your nipples and areolas may begin darkening or changing as early as the first or second week, and some women also find that their darkened areolas and darkened nipples grow larger in diameter, especially as the breasts begin to swell.

How do areolas change in early pregnancy?

Darker Areolas: The sensitive skin that makes up your areolas may become darker over the course of your pregnancy, or later in the second or third trimester. This is because pregnancy hormones can cause your skin cells to produce more pigment.

Does areola darken before period?

Menstruation

The hormones estrogen and progesterone may make your breasts become swollen or tender before and during your period, which comes on average every 21 to 35 days. Some women also notice that their nipples darken before their menstrual periods or during ovulation — when hormones are shifting.

What color do your nipples turn in early pregnancy?

Like many pregnancy symptoms and side-effects, dark or black areolas are most likely a result of your rising levels of hormones—namely, estrogen and progesterone. These two hormones may increase the production of pigment in your skin.

What are the little bumps on my areola?

Montgomery glands

The darker area of skin around the nipple is called the areola. On the areola there are some little raised bumps. These are quite normal and are called Montgomery glands. They produce fluid to moisturise the nipple.

Why are the bumps on my nipples getting bigger?

The bumps on the areola are known as 'Montgomery glands'. The bumps on the areola are known as 'Montgomery glands'. Montgomery glands are not visible until you are aroused or pregnant. During pregnancy, as breasts increase in size for breastfeeding, the Montgomery glands also swell.

How soon do Montgomery tubercles appear in pregnancy?

Montgomery's tubercles around your nipples may be one of the first symptoms of pregnancy. They may be noticeable even before you've missed your period. Not every woman who experiences Montgomery's tubercles is pregnant. If you notice these bumps and have other pregnancy symptoms, you should take a home pregnancy test.

What is the white dry stuff on my nipples not pregnant?

Galactorrhoea is milky nipple discharge not related to pregnancy or breast feeding. It is caused by the abnormal production of a hormone called prolactin. This can be caused by diseases of glands elsewhere in the body which control hormone secretion, such as the pituitary and thyroid glands.
